The four modules
Each module is a 90-minute live working session – facilitated, not lectured. Across the four weeks, we move you from “we know we need a plan” to “we have a plan our board can approve.”
01
We work out your real carbon footprint – across your direct operations and the things that matter in your supply chain – and agree which sustainability issues actually matter for your business. You leave session 1 with an honest baseline you can stand behind in front of a board.
02
A clear, costed plan with real numbers – not a wish list. We help you set a target that’s achievable, pick the right funding routes (grants, low-carbon finance, internal budget), and end the session with a six-quarter delivery plan.
03
How you actually shift how people work, day to day. What’s expected of each role, how you train them, how you talk about it internally, how it shows up in performance reviews. You leave with a workforce plan that survives a reorganisation.
04
What you say externally – to customers, investors, lenders and tender buyers. Which reporting standard fits you, how the story is told, and a quick check that nothing reads as greenwashing. Output: a drafted board paper ready for sign-off.

Senior leadership teams (typically CEO, COO, CFO, Sustainability Lead, Head of Risk) who need a credible plan they can take to the board – without spending a quarter on it. Cohorts are usually 6–10 senior leaders.
Yes – and arguably more valuable. SMEs rarely have a sustainability lead in-house, and the cost of getting strategy wrong is bigger relative to the business. The Sprint gives an SME leadership team a clear plan, an honest carbon picture, and a board-ready paper in four weeks. We run discounted SME seats on cohort intakes – ask in the discovery call.
Both. The cohort runs quarterly with leaders from non-competing sectors (£6,500-£12,500/cohort). In-house is delivered for your team only. Same content, same outcome, different rhythm.
It’s a 12–15 page document that pulls everything together – your carbon footprint, the issues that matter most for your business, your targets, your funding options, your people plan and your reporting roadmap, plus a six-quarter delivery plan. It’s what your board needs to approve the work and release the budget. You walk out of the Sprint with one drafted, ready to sign off.
